Author Event Fundraiser

Hillsborough writer Jan Irwin will be celebrating the release of her debut novel Finding Your Place at a launch party and reading on Saturday, Sept. 6, from 2:00-5:00 p.m. at the Burwell School Historic Site. To recognize the contributions to our community by both the FOCPL and the Burwell School, Jan is donating $1 from every book sold at the event to each of those organizations.

Her middle-grade historical novel tells the story of life in central North Carolina in1894, when a family is forced to leave their failing farm and try to make a new life for themselves at one of the new cotton mills springing up in the area. The novel recounts the challenges and emotions 11-year-old Ginny faces as she tries to find her place in that strange environment and new way of life.

The celebration features a reading at 3:30, live music, cookies and ice cream, temporary tattoos, and children’s games from the 1890s. Join the fun, and bring any 8-12 year-olds you know with you! Local author John Claude Bemis says about Jan’s book: “The evocative world of Ginny’s mill village will capture the imaginations of children as well as adults. And young Ginny–as she struggles with change, friendships, and family–will capture readers’ hearts. Get ready for an unforgettable read!” You can learn more at Jan’s website, www.janiceirwin.com.
